The Science of Cheese Melting

Cheese is a complex food product made from the proteins and fats of milk. When melted, these components undergo a transformation, resulting in a smooth, creamy texture that is both appealing to the palate and visually appealing.

The temperature at which cheese melts is critical, as overheating can result in a rubbery or burnt texture. A delicate balance of heat and time is essential for achieving the perfect melt, which is often influenced by factors such as the type of cheese, the moisture content, and the presence of additives.
